MoU SIGNED BETWEEN DVC AND REC for one-stop-shop for financing .
NEW DELHI. A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) is signed between Damodar Valley Corporation and Rural Electrification Company (REC) on 22th March, 2017 at DVC Towers, Kolkata. The MoU is signed by Shri Andrew W K Langstieh, IA&AS, Chairman, DVC and Dr. P.V. Ramesh, IAS, Chairman & Managing Director, REC, in presence of Shri P. K. Mukhopadhyay, Member-Secretary & Member(Finance), DVC ,ShriRP.Tripathi,Member (Technical) DVC, Shri S K Gupta, Director (Technical), REC and Mrs. Ritu Maheswari, IAS, Executive Director (T&D), REC. The said MoU would ensure one-stop-shop for financing ongoing and upcoming projects of DVC on the best and most competitive terms for the next five years.
